Common Thread CSA Common Thread CSA is a family farm in Madison, NY. We grow vegetables using sustainable methods and market locally through CSA and farmers markets.
(1)

We farm because we love working closely with the earth, and producing good, healthy food for our local communities. CSA shares are available on the farm in Madison as well as at drop off sites in Cazenovia, Cicero, Clinton, Dewitt, Fairmount, Fayetteville, Manlius, Syracuse and Utica. 06/14/2026

Went across the creek to explore the edge of the wetland again yesterday and discovered that the iris back there is blue flag! Also saw cool purple avens pods and sedges. The last picture is the hairy beardtongue patch we planted last year on the farm . So pretty!

06/02/2026

Fun walk behind the creek the other day! I found blooming hawthornes and nanny berries, some neat sedges, water or purple avens which I thought looked like prairie smoke and turns out to be in the same genus, I think an iris but still waiting for it to flower so I can ID it, various willow shrubs which continue to be very hard to ID but fun to watch them change though the seasons and a caterpillar enjoying red osier dogwood
